How much do pet food packaging j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for pet food packaging in the United States is $18.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.35 and $19.71 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a pet food packaging?

A Pet Food Packaging job involves preparing, packing, and labeling pet food products for distribution and sale. Responsibilities may include operating packaging machinery, inspecting products for quality, and ensuring proper storage and handling. Workers must follow safety and hygiene standards to maintain product quality. This role is essential in delivering well-packaged and safe pet food to customers.

What does a typical shift look like for someone in a pet food packaging role?

A typical shift in Pet Food Packaging involves setting up and operating packaging equipment, inspecting products for quality, labeling, and stacking finished packages for shipment. Team members often rotate among tasks to maintain efficiency and may assist in cleaning equipment or organizing inventory during downtime. The role often requires working on your feet for extended periods and may include lifting moderate weights. Collaboration with quality control, machine operators, and warehouse staff is common to ensure seamless production. Adhering to safety standards and maintaining cleanliness are also daily priorities in this environ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the pet food packaging position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Pet Food Packaging, you need attention to detail, physical stamina, and knowledge of basic health and safety protocols. Experience with packaging machinery, inventory management systems, or certifications in food safety can be beneficial. Reliable teamwork, time management, and effective communication help distinguish top performers in this position. These skills are vital for maintaining quality, safety, and efficiency in a fast-paced production environment.

Your Opportunity as the Senior Technologist, Packaging Research & Development, Pet

Shape the future of pet food packaging at Smucker! In this hands-on innovation role, you'll develop and launch new packaging solutions that protect product quality, enhance sustainability, and deliver a better consumer experience. Working cross-functionally with suppliers and manufacturing teams, you'll lead package development from concept and testing through commercialization while driving continuous improvement and sustainable packaging initiatives. If you're passionate about packaging technology, problem-solving, and bringing new ideas to life, this is an opportunity to make a meaningful impact on iconic pet brands. 🐾

Location: Orrville, OH

Work Arrangements: Hybrid, 60% or more in office presence as business need requires. Travel up to 30% annually.

In this role you will:

  • Collaborate boldly with Product R&D, Creative Services, Brand Management, Purchasing, and Suppliers to bring new packaging concepts to life-starting from the earliest design stages.

  • Design and develop innovative packaging solutions using materials like film/laminate, thermoforming, injection molding, paperboard, and corrugated formats-driven by consumer needs and business goals.

  • Lead testing and validation of packaging performance across production, distribution, shelf life, sustainability, and consumer usability-with growing independence.

  • Execute qualifications and trials with suppliers and production facilities, ensuring seamless integration into our manufacturing processes.

  • Drive plant trials with precision-planning, executing, analyzing, and summarizing results in partnership with manufacturing and technical teams.

  • Craft performance-based specifications and manage them within our electronic database system.

  • Advise and recommend top-tier suppliers and service providers to support successful product launches.

  • Champion innovation by proposing new packaging technologies, sustainability solutions, cost-saving ideas, and creative problem-solving approaches.

  • Support technical troubleshooting across the packaging supply chain and production environments.

  • Learn to assess legal and environmental aspects, and patent opportunities for new packaging

  • Build strong relationships with strategic packaging suppliers to stay ahead of trends and capabilities.

What we are looking for:

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or of Science degree in Packaging Science/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Material Science or related technical degree

  • 2+ years of experience in packaging development or packaging engineering

  • Knowledge ofpackaging materials, technologies, andapplications

  • Understanding ofbasic package attributes andqualification test procedures

  • Experience collaborating acrossmulti-functionaland discipline boundaries in a dynamic project environment

  • Experience conducting plant and lab trials

  • Ability to lift up to 30 lbs.

  • Willingness to travel up to 30% based on project needs and launch schedules

Additional skills and experiences that we think would make someone successful in this role:

  • Experience in the food or beverage industry

  • Familiaritywith packing line machinery and equipment (ex: flexible pouch, bagging, rigidcontainerfillingand sealing, case packing etc.)
